Output 51c731f0b287bad3ab9977c3a6f672c7a4e504b16af0ce60eb635f5c316efadc: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8fd52a847e193bf0333731050b399d85d7d32fc OP_EQUAL
address
3MUMMAKFYx4iCAh3YCRFk73XG2uRdJErXE
transaction
51c731f0b287bad3ab9977c3a6f672c7a4e504b16af0ce60eb635f5c316efadc
spent
true